    This place gets 5 stars as to how they make the ice cream rolls, and as far as presentation is concerned. The available toppings gets 5 stars, but the flavor of the ice cream was just average. I had to try their Halo Halo, since the name and their ingredients were similar to a Filipino dessert. It had coconut jelly, jackfruit, coconut flakes, whipped cream, condensed milk, 2 strawberry wafers and ube ice cream. It tasted similar to a Filipino halo halo. The only reason that I did not give this place 5 stars is because I am accustomed to a more flavorful ube ice cream. My son enjoyed his Thai Tea Oreo. It consisted of Thai tea Oreo ice cream with Oreo crumbs, mini mochi and condensed milk. He said that it was good but, the mochi was harder than most. I would definitely suggest going to this place to watch how rolled ice cream is made.
